By Matthew Reisen / Journal Staff Writer Copyright © 2022 Albuquerque Journal In their first weeks, the city's new speed cameras clocked one driver rocketing down Montgomery at 130 mph. Another was traveling 119 mph on Gibson. They were among thousands caught breaking the law on Albuquerque's streets. In all, Albuquerque Police Department spokeswoman Rebecca Atkins said the three speed cameras on Gibson and Montgomery have racked up more than 2,500 "approved" speeding violations since May 25 – fining the drivers 0 or requiring community service.
